Throughout naming history, B names have experienced three major waves of popularity. Betty dominated the 1920s through 1940s. Barbara reigned supreme from the 1940s to 1960s. Brittany captured hearts during the 1980s and 1990s. Today, we are seeing a fresh resurgence of beautiful B names for girls, blending vintage charm with contemporary appeal.

Most Popular Girl Names Starting with B

Let us explore the B names currently capturing parents' hearts across the United States. These trending choices combine appealing sounds with meaningful origins.

Brooklyn - The Reigning B Name Champion

Brooklyn stands as the undisputed leader among girl names starting with B. This place name, derived from the Dutch meaning "broken land" or "marshland," gained massive popularity after David and Victoria Beckham chose it for their son in 1999. For girls, Brooklyn offers urban sophistication with a feminine twist. Variations include Brooklynn and Brooklin.

Bella and Brielle - Italian Romance Rising

Bella means "beautiful" in Italian and Latin. This gorgeous name works wonderfully as a standalone choice or as a nickname for Isabella. The Twilight series significantly boosted its popularity.

Brielle carries the Hebrew meaning "God is my strength." This modern creation combines the popular "Bri" sound with the elegant "Elle" ending. Nickname options include Bri and Elle.

Blair and Brooke - Sophisticated Short Names

Blair has emerged as one of the fastest-rising B names, currently ranked #218 in U.S. births. This Scottish Gaelic name meaning "plain" or "field" gained tremendous momentum from the Gossip Girl character.

Brooke remains a classic choice meaning "small stream" in English. This nature-inspired name maintains enduring appeal thanks to actress Brooke Shields.

Rare and Unique B Names for Girls Who Stand Out

For parents seeking distinctive names that will not be shared with multiple classmates, these rare girl names starting with B offer beautiful sounds and fascinating origins.

Mythological and Literary B Names

  • Briseis (bri-SEE-is) - Meaning "daughter of Briseus," this Greek mythology name from The Iliad offers literary sophistication with a unique sound.
  • Branwen (BRAN-wen) - This Welsh name meaning "beautiful raven" belongs to a goddess of love and beauty in Celtic mythology.
  • Bellatrix (bel-AH-triks) - Latin for "female warrior," this name also identifies a star in the Orion constellation. Harry Potter fans will recognize it.
  • Belphoebe - A literary creation meaning "beautiful Phoebe," perfect for book-loving families.

Botanical and Nature-Inspired Rarities

  • Bryony (BRY-oh-nee) - This Greek name refers to a climbing vine plant, offering English countryside charm.
  • Begonia (beh-GOHN-yah) - An unusual flower name with vintage appeal, named after Botanist Michel Begon.
  • Briar (BRY-er) - Meaning "thorny patch" or "wild rose," this name connects to Sleeping Beauty's true name, Briar Rose.
  • Bluebell - A whimsical wildflower name with fairy-tale charm, chosen by Geri Halliwell for her daughter.

International Hidden Gems

  • Bao (bow) - Chinese and Vietnamese for "treasure" or "precious," simple yet profound.
  • Boglarka (BOG-lar-ka) - Hungarian for "buttercup," truly one-of-a-kind.
  • Bahija (bah-HEE-jah) - Arabic meaning "happy" or "joyful."
  • Behnoosh - Persian for "sweet melody."
  • Bijou - French for "jewel."

Classic and Vintage B Names Making a Comeback

Timeless vintage girl names starting with B are experiencing renewed interest, perfect for parents who love old-fashioned charm with modern appeal.

Victorian and Edwardian Era Treasures

  • Beatrice - Beloved by royals including Princess Beatrice, this was also Dante's muse. Nicknames include Bea, Trixie, and Betty.
  • Bernadette - Germanic meaning "brave as a bear," associated with Saint Bernadette of Lourdes.
  • Blanche - French for "white, fair," with literary connections to A Streetcar Named Desire.
  • Beryl - A gemstone name with elegant vintage appeal.

Mid-Century Classics Ready for Revival

  • Barbara - Greek meaning "foreign, strange," this 1940s-60s icon is ready for a grandma-chic comeback. Nicknames: Barb, Barbie, Babs.
  • Betty - Hebrew meaning "God is my oath" (from Elizabeth). Betty White's legacy and Betty Boop's charm keep this name lovable.
  • Bonnie - Scottish for "pretty one," with 1940s charm and Bonnie and Clyde romance.

Vintage Nickname Names as Standalone Choices

  • Birdie - English for "little bird," chosen by actress Busy Philipps for her daughter.
  • Billie - Germanic meaning "resolute protector," experiencing a surge thanks to Billie Eilish.
  • Bertie - Germanic for "bright, famous," quirky with distinctive comeback potential.
  • Bess/Bessie - Charming Elizabeth nicknames.

Biblical and Spiritual Girl Names Starting with B

These meaningful names from religious texts and spiritual traditions offer deep significance for families seeking faith-based options.

Old Testament Names with Deep Roots

  • Bathsheba (bath-SHEE-bah) - Hebrew meaning "daughter of the oath," the biblical queen and mother of Solomon. Nickname: Sheba.
  • Bethany - Hebrew for "house of figs," a village near Jerusalem. This name has a warm, approachable sound.
  • Beulah - Hebrew meaning "married, bride," a biblical land name from Isaiah 62:4.
  • Bethel - Hebrew for "house of God."

Names with Divine Meaning

  • Bithiah - Hebrew meaning "daughter of Yahweh," the Egyptian princess who saved Moses.
  • Berenice/Bernice - Greek meaning "bringer of victory," appears in Acts 25-26.
  • Beth - Short form meaning "house of God."

Saint Names and Christian Heritage

  • Brigid/Bridget - St. Brigid of Ireland, patron saint of scholars. Originally a Celtic goddess who transitioned to Christian saint.
  • Bernadette - St. Bernadette of Lourdes, known for miraculous visions. A French Catholic tradition.
  • Barbara - Saint Barbara, patron of architects and mathematicians.

Frequently Asked Questions About B Names for Girls

What is the most popular girl name starting with B?

Brooklyn is currently the most popular girl name starting with B in the United States. Other highly popular B names include Bella, Brielle, Brianna, and the rapidly rising Blair, which has climbed significantly in recent years to reach #218.

What girl name means beautiful starting with B?

Bella is the most direct choice, meaning "beautiful" in Italian and Latin. Belle offers the French version with the same meaning. Bonnie (Scottish for "pretty, charming"), Bianca ("white, shining"), and Belinda ("beautiful, bright") also carry beauty-related meanings for parents seeking this symbolism.

What are rare B names for girls?

Truly rare B names include Briseis (Greek mythology), Boglarka (Hungarian for "buttercup"), Branwen (Welsh goddess), Blythe ("happy" in Old English), and Begonia (unusual flower name). These distinctive choices ensure your daughter will not share her name with classmates while maintaining beautiful sounds and meaningful origins.

What are old fashioned girl names that start with B?

Vintage B names experiencing revival include Beatrice (Victorian elegance), Betty (1920s charm), Barbara (mid-century classic), Bernadette (French saint name), and Birdie (whimsical nickname name). These old-fashioned choices offer nostalgic appeal while feeling fresh for the new generation of babies.

What are strong girl names that start with B?

Strong B names include Bridget/Brigid (meaning "strength, exalted one"), Briana (Celtic for "strong, noble"), Bellona (Roman war goddess), Brunhilde (Norse for "battle armor"), and Bellatrix (Latin for "female warrior"). These powerful names convey courage and resilience for confident daughters.

What biblical names start with B for girls?

Biblical B names include Bathsheba (daughter of the oath, mother of Solomon), Bethany (house of figs, village near Jerusalem), Berenice (bringer of victory, Acts 25-26), and Beulah (married, bride from Isaiah). These names carry deep scriptural significance for families of faith.

What are some cute short B names for girls?

Adorable short B names include Bea (one syllable, from Beatrice), Bree (Irish for strength), Bay (nature name), Belle (beautiful in French), Beth (from Elizabeth), and Blair (Scottish sophistication). These brief names pack personality into minimal syllables while remaining memorable and distinctive.

Which celebrities have babies with B names?

Celebrity B-name babies include Brooklyn (David and Victoria Beckham), Betty as a middle name (Ryan Reynolds and Blake Lively's daughter), Birdie (Busy Philipps), and Blue Ivy (Beyonce). The Gossip Girl character Blair has also influenced the name's rising popularity among parents.
